Output 385a1b0251f43c60e4e338f1696363e26b1a1060a33f66a12078099f8766230e:9

value
63234821
script pubkey
OP_0 OP_PUSHBYTES_20 725b97fc2af3a0b63683c4e5035eda54c7f218d7
address
ltc1qwfde0lp27wstvd5rcnjsxhk62nrlyxxh25nlwy
transaction
385a1b0251f43c60e4e338f1696363e26b1a1060a33f66a12078099f8766230e
spent
true